According to proponents of raw foodism, food heated above 104–118°F (40–48°C) loses valuable nutrients and enzymes, which is why a typical raw diet focuses on uncooked, unprocessed ingredients. This eating plan is centered around consuming a diverse range of plant-based foods in their most natural state, with some variations including raw animal products.
